Cultural practices & uses
Sacred hill/grove; trees not cut, hill not ploughed; ritual gatherings
Plant species
Native Estonian forest/hill flora
Biome & fauna
Boreal hemiboreal forest & moraine landscape
Threats & protection
Folkloric protection; revival & legal-protection campaigns (Hiite Maja / Sacred Natural Sites)
